How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Bayard?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Bayard Studio Apartments | $1,612 | $799 | $2,600 |
Bayard 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,170 | $500 | $3,100 |
Bayard 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,655 | $575 | $4,200 |
Bayard 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,353 | $987 | $2,031 |
Bayard 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,338 | $1,250 | $1,504 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Bayard
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Bayard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Bayard ranges from $500 to $3,100 with an average monthly rent of $1,170.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Bayard c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Bayard range from $575 to $4,200.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,655.
How expensive are Bayard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 10 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Bayard on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$987 to $2,031 - averaging $1,353 for the location.
